Name a signature seafood option and its basic preparation.

Explanation:
A signature seafood option should be immediately recognizable, broadly appealing, and simple to prepare well in a busy kitchen. Grilled salmon fits this idea perfectly. Its name clearly identifies the protein and the cooking method, and salmon is a popular, versatile fish that most guests expect to see on a menu. The basic prep—seasoned and grilled—keeps flavors approachable and reliable in timing, while a light sauce or topping adds a gentle finish without overpowering the dish. This combination creates a dish that feels emblematic of the restaurant’s seafood offerings and easy to describe to guests as a staple highlight. The other options are tasty but less likely to be seen as signature items. A pan-seared tuna with citrus glaze is more niche and has a stronger, more distinctive flavor profile that may not appeal to every guest. Fried shrimp with cocktail sauce leans into casual, bar-style fare rather than a signature, refined option. Baked cod with lemon butter is solid but reads more as a standard preparation than a standout signature dish.
